The image shows the Jonathan Corwin House, also known as The Witch House, located in Salem, Massachusetts. The building features a clapboard exterior with double-hung windows. A sign identifies it as the "Witch House," and several commercial signs are displayed, including those for a plumber and a laundry. The structure is two stories tall with a prominent roof and visible utility wires above.
